John Lewis spends £21m to upgrade Peterborough store

John Lewis & Partners is giving its store in the Queensgate shopping centre a multi-million pound makeover to introduce new features and experiences in a bid to attract more shoppers.

The 93,000-square-foot Peterborough shop is in line for a £21 million revamp that will include an overhaul and reconfiguration of the entire space plus the addition of new services.

Customers can a new womenswear department on the upper ground floor, as well as a refreshed Beauty Hall with new brands and services. And a new external loading bay will improve access to a new collection point, making it easier for customers to collect their click & collect orders.

At the centre of the new store concept is John Lewis’ new personalised experiences and the revamped shop will offer plenty of these. An Experience Desk located on the upper ground floor will provide a concierge-style service, helping customers book a number of different services that will be on offer in the shop.

In the womenswear department there will be a Style Studio, where individual customers or groups can get styling advice and ideas from a team of personal stylists. And the Beauty Hall will feature a new beauty concierge-style service, with trained staff offering independent advice across the full range of brands.

“As retail is changing it is important for us to respond to the needs of our customers. The investment in the shop will create new and exciting experiences, while giving our customers in Peterborough a new level of personalised and curated shopping,” explained Gary Rowntree, head of branch at John Lewis & Partners Peterborough.

Due to be completed by January 2020, the new John Lewis store is one of several developments taking place at Queensgate shopping centre. The mall owned by Invesco Real Estate and managed by LendLease is also building a £60m extension that is opening in Autumn 2021.

“The £60m extension, anchored by a ten-screen Empire Cinema, will sit alongside new restaurant brands and bring further opportunities whilst position Queensgate as a significant retail and leisure destination,” said Guy Thomas, head of retail at Lendlease.
